About This Item

1936. MARINETTI, F.T. et al. Azione Imperiale. Rassegna della Creazione Fascista. Volumes 1 and 2 (all published). 72 and 68 pp., illustrated throughout with photographs. Small folio, 328 x 225 mm., bound in publisher's illustrated wrappers, in new cloth folding boxes. Rome: G. Luzzati, 1936. A classic example of fascist propaganda, edited by Marinetti, profusely illustrated with photographs and photomontages, and with a splendidly illustrated front wrapper. Rare, with OCLC listing only the University of Wisconsin at Madison and the National Library in Rome, both with Volume 1 only.
